What Happens When You Overload?

So, ever wonder how overloading your vehicle could affect its air brake system? Here’s the scoop: when a vehicle is overloaded, its stopping distance increases.

You see, heavier loads mean more force is needed to slow down and stop, thanks to the good old laws of physics. More mass equals greater inertia, making it harder for your vehicle to come to a halt. Think of it like trying to stop a train versus stopping a bicycle; the train just can’t stop on a dime, right?

The Mechanics Behind Stopping Distances

So, why does this happen? Increased stopping distance is mainly due to the added weight that - you guessed it - requires more force to decelerate. As the vehicle’s mass grows, it not only takes longer to stop but also can wear those brake components faster than usual.

Brake fade can become a real issue too. This occurs when brakes get overheated from the constant friction, especially during heavy braking situations. And trust me, brake fade is like trying to cook a steak on a cold grill—it just doesn’t work!
